在 TokenPocket (TP) 钱包中取消代币授权的全面指南与未来展望

摘要:代币授权(approve/allowance)是去中心化生态里常见的权限机制,但滥用或长期无限授权会带来被盗风险。本文首先给出在 TokenPocket(TP)钱包内取消/管理代币授权的实操步骤与常见问题,然后从安全知识、专业视角、创新数字生态、私密资产管理与账户整合五个维度展开探讨,并提出未来智能化社会下的演进方向与建议。

一、为何需要取消代币授权

- ERC20/ERC721/ERC1155 等代币允许用户授予合约或地址操作代币的权限(如 transferFrom / setApprovalForAll)。

- 常见风险:无限额度(approve MAX_UINT)被恶意合约利用;DApp 被攻破或恶意后门触发转账;钓鱼网站诱导签名。

- 最佳实践:只授权最小必要额度,交易后及时撤销或设置过期策略。

二、在 TP 钱包中取消授权的实操步骤(移动端和扩展可能略有差异)

1. 打开 TokenPocket,选择对应链与钱包地址(确保为你授权时所用的地址)。

2. 在“我的/资产/设置/安全”或侧边菜单中查找“授权管理/权限管理/已连接应用”(不同版本位置可能不同)。

3. 进入后会看到已授权的 DApp 列表或代币授权详情(若 TP 无内置管理工具,可使用第三方工具,见下文)。

4. 选择要撤销的授权,点击“撤销/断开/移除”并确认交易(撤销 ERC20 授权通常需要在链上提交一笔交易并支付 gas,建议在网络费低时操作)。

5. 常见撤销方式:将 allowance 设置为 0;对于 setApprovalForAll 类型的授权,调用 setApprovalForAll(spender, false)。

6. 检查交易在链上确认后,重新查看授权状态以确保撤销成功。

三、若 TP 无内置撤销功能,可用的替代工具

- Revoke.cash、Etherscan Token Approvals(以太坊)、BscScan Approvals(BSC)、Debank、Zapper 等。

- 使用步骤通常为:在工具网站选择对应链,连接 TP 钱包(谨慎核对域名与证书),加载已授权列表,选择撤销并在钱包中签名交易。

四、操作注意事项与安全知识

- 永远核对合约地址与 DApp 域名;不要在可疑页面上签名任意消息或交易。

- 撤销本身需要链上交易并支付 gas,谨慎权衡成本与风险。

- 有些 ERC20 实现要求先将权限设为 0 再改为新额度;若撤销失败,先尝试 0 再更改。

- 使用硬件钱包或冷钱包提高私钥安全;使用独立“操作账户”与“冷藏账户”分离风险。

五、私密资产管理与账户整合策略

- 分层账户:把小额用于交互、授权的“热钱包”与长期持有的“冷钱包”分开。

- 多签/社群托管或时间锁合约可降低单点被盗风险。

- 账户整合:定期汇总各链资产,采用跨链桥或正规聚合器时要注意合约安全与流动性风险。

- 使用智能账户(account abstraction)或社交恢复钱包可以在未来更方便地管理多地址和权限。

六、专业视角与合规审视

- 企业或托管机构应建立授权审批与审计流程:定期导出 allowance 报表、风险分级、事件响应机制。

- 合规方面,需注意 KYC/AML 要求与合作方资质,尤其涉及托管与集中服务时。

七、创新数字生态与未来智能化社会展望

- 自动化与智能合约将推动“最小权限原则”的自动执行:按策略动态授予与自动回收权限(如基于时间窗口或行为触发)。

- AI 与代理将代替人工签名日常授权,但这要求更高的身份与密钥管理协议(如阈值签名、多方计算、可验证计算)。

- 隐私增强技术(零知识证明、可验证凭证)可实现更细粒度且隐私保护的权限委托。

八、总结与建议清单

- 操作建议:定期检查并撤销不必要的授权;优先使用有限额度;在可信环境下使用第三方撤销工具;采用冷钱包保管核心资产。

- 战略建议:为长期发展考虑引入多签与智能账户,采用自动化审计工具,关注并参与标准层面的改进(例如更安全的许可模型与可撤销委托标准)。

通过上述步骤和策略,你可以在 TokenPocket 中有效管理与撤销代币授权,降低被盗风险,并为向智能化、隐私保护更强的数字资产管理生态转型做好准备。

作者:李晓辰发布时间:2025-10-06 18:19:07

评论

Sam88

讲得很全面,尤其是替代工具和操作注意事项部分,已经去检查了我的授权!

币圈小白

太实用了,原来撤销授权也会花 gas,我之前都不知道。

CryptoNeko

期待未来有更多自动化的授权回收机制,文章对智能账户的展望很有启发。

王大锤

多谢,按步骤操作后成功把不需要的授权撤掉,推荐大家定期清理。

相关阅读